Solution

Working with Microsoft’s Brand team, under the Music x Tech programme in concert with Childish Gambino, we conceived, scripted, designed and created an original live shared immersive and in home virtual reality experience.

Pharos was the world’s first musical short story in virtual reality with music act Childish Gambino, alter ego of the multitalented Donald Glover. Through a bold exploration in emotional reality, we created both a physical experience, augmented by digital, in tandem with an in home experience. Three different types of engagement, all created from one real-time production pipeline.

Thousands of festival goers gathered in California’s Joshua Tree National Park under a massive projection dome for the Pharos concert. As the audience looked up above the central stage, they were propelled into an imaginary 3D world – a giant, shared virtual reality experience that blended the physical reality of the live concert with real-time 3D animation to create a truly out-of-this-world experience. The show was made available for fans to experience at home on an immersive app, taking them from the front row of the Joshua Tree concert into a spellbinding virtual universe; all run in real-time.

Results

This epic challenge saw us combine live music, high-tech and immersive effects to create a live performance never seen before. Working closely with Donald to bring his vision to life, we invented an interactive visual narrative that enriched the live performance and took the audience mood and energy to new heights.

This was a unique opportunity to showcase how real-time, immersive technology is transforming the way content is created and how it creates for deeper audience connection.

Overall, we delivered purchase intent for Microsoft of 79% for 18-35-year-olds. We delivered 182m impressions including 1.1m video views at full dwell time and 338 unique press articles along with features in Wired, Billboard and Rolling Stone magazine. Pharos was awarded Gold and Silver in the Clio Awards, among others.
